aboutsummaryrefslogtreecommitdiffstats
path: root/build/ci.go
diff options
context:
space:
mode:
authorPéter Szilágyi <peterke@gmail.com>2018-07-25 22:51:24 +0800
committerPéter Szilágyi <peterke@gmail.com>2018-07-25 23:04:43 +0800
commit6b232ce3252c6823ac84cd3d2256340f981cd387 (patch)
tree78ec24d6836fb981addafbf0013c40be0568f0a8 /build/ci.go
parent7abedf9bbb725da8d610762d051af43085be1cda (diff)
downloaddexon-6b232ce3252c6823ac84cd3d2256340f981cd387.tar.gz
dexon-6b232ce3252c6823ac84cd3d2256340f981cd387.tar.zst
dexon-6b232ce3252c6823ac84cd3d2256340f981cd387.zip
internal, vendor: update Azure blobstore API
Diffstat (limited to 'build/ci.go')
-rw-r--r--build/ci.go13
1 files changed, 2 insertions, 11 deletions
diff --git a/build/ci.go b/build/ci.go
index 29b43783c..7d22b5255 100644
--- a/build/ci.go
+++ b/build/ci.go
@@ -1018,23 +1018,14 @@ func doPurge(cmdline []string) {
}
for i := 0; i < len(blobs); i++ {
for j := i + 1; j < len(blobs); j++ {
- iTime, err := time.Parse(time.RFC1123, blobs[i].Properties.LastModified)
- if err != nil {
- log.Fatal(err)
- }
- jTime, err := time.Parse(time.RFC1123, blobs[j].Properties.LastModified)
- if err != nil {
- log.Fatal(err)
- }
- if iTime.After(jTime) {
+ if blobs[i].Properties.LastModified.After(blobs[j].Properties.LastModified) {
blobs[i], blobs[j] = blobs[j], blobs[i]
}
}
}
// Filter out all archives more recent that the given threshold
for i, blob := range blobs {
- timestamp, _ := time.Parse(time.RFC1123, blob.Properties.LastModified)
- if time.Since(timestamp) < time.Duration(*limit)*24*time.Hour {
+ if time.Since(blob.Properties.LastModified) < time.Duration(*limit)*24*time.Hour {
blobs = blobs[:i]
break
}